A casual hand-drawn print with rounded strokes and softly irregular contours. Letterforms are mostly upright with a lively, uneven rhythm: stroke endings vary, curves wobble slightly, and spacing feels organic rather than mechanically uniform. Proportions fluctuate from glyph to glyph, producing a natural, hand-rendered texture; counters are generally open and shapes stay readable at text sizes despite the informal construction.
Works well for short-to-medium text where a friendly handmade voice is desired: posters, invitations, product labels, educational materials, and informal branding. It’s particularly effective in headings, callouts, and captions where a natural marker-note texture adds charm without sacrificing legibility.
The overall tone is approachable and lightly whimsical, like quick marker lettering on a note or classroom poster. Its imperfect edges and buoyant spacing create a warm, human feel that reads as informal and conversational rather than polished or corporate.
Designed to capture the spontaneity of hand lettering in a clean, readable print style—prioritizing warmth, personality, and an authentic drawn texture over strict geometric consistency.
Capitals are simple and open with minimal ornament, while lowercase forms keep a straightforward printed structure rather than connecting. Numerals match the same loose, handwritten logic, with a slightly quirky presence that supports the font’s casual personality.
